From 84a64607a37d0767fdd40ed5ba31c24962951cb9 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Simon Glass Date: Wed, 31 Dec 2025 07:54:23 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] sandbox: Add --quiet_vidconsole option to speed up output When running sandbox with lots of console output, the vidconsole slows things down significantly since it renders truetype fonts to the internal framebuffer. Add a -Q/--quiet_vidconsole command-line option that removes vidconsole from stdout and stderr, using only the serial console. This can provide a ~300x speedup for output-heavy operations.
